In Vitro (Adverb)

Meaning

In an artificial environment outside the living organism; "an egg fertilized in vitro".

Examples

  • The scientists successfully grew the cells in vitro by providing them with the necessary nutrients.
  • Stem cells are often studied in vitro to better understand their potential for regeneration.
  • Human embryos are sometimes conceived in vitro through the process of in vitro fertilization.
  • Biologists often attempt to recreate natural ecosystems in vitro in laboratory experiments.
  • The bacteria were observed in vitro under controlled temperature and humidity conditions.
